-Cola, and became a hit record. The TV commercial, entitled "Hilltop", was directed by Haskell Wexler. The first attempt at shooting was ruined by rain and other location problems. The eventual total cost of the commercial was $250000 — an unheard of price in 1971 for an advertisement. The finished product, first aired in July 1971, featured a multicultural group of young people lip syncing the song on a hill outside Rome, Italy.
